UT Medical Center Featured on Patient Power: Lowering High Cholesterol

You may not want to watch your cholesterol intake, but your life depends upon it. High cholesterol levels can put you at risk for coronary heart disease, stroke and heart attacks.

UT Medical Center staff and patient interviews with Patient Power, a company dedicated to helping you and your loved ones gain the knowledge needed to make the smartest choices about your health as you seek to fight back against a serious health concern, to share their stories and experience on this important topic.

According to the American Heart Association an estimated 106.7 million adults in the United States have total blood cholesterol values of 200 mg/dL and higher, and of these, about 37.2 million American adults have dangerous levels of 240 or above.

Expert Dr. Jeffrey Johnson, a cardiologist at the UT Medical Center; Jane Kelly, a registered nurse at UT Medical Center, who shared how a healthy diet can make all the difference; and patient Debra Winston participate in this discussion.
